Mother was diagnosed with wet macular and they caught it quickly. The
retina specialist suggest she try a new drug [only approved by the FDA
for colen rectal cancer]. The dr.s have found that injecting this
stuff can stop and in some cases reverse the disease. it is one of the
mab drugs called Avastin. Newest info on a site medrounds. something
thinking org and in blog form. even 3 months ago they were using
infusions of it but discovered that injecting work just as well and
didn't fiddle with the rest of the body.
